Sophie

Sophie

distrib > Fedora > 13 > i386 > media > updates-src > by-pkgid > c8be1bdf844f2b79cac5b451ef942a9b > files > 2

kdevelop-pg-qt-0.9.0-3.fc13.src.rpm


Name:           kdevelop-pg-qt
Summary:        A parser generator 
Version:        0.9.0
Release:        3%{?dist}

# All LGPLv2+, except for bison-generated kdev-pg-parser.{cc.h} which are GPLv2+
License:        LGPLv2+ and GPLv2+ with exception
Group:          Development/Tools
URL:            http://techbase.kde.org/Development/KDevelop-PG-Qt_Introduction
Source0:        ftp://ftp.kde.org/pub/kde/stable/kdevelop-pg-qt/%{version}/src/kdevelop-pg-qt-%{version}.tar.bz2
BuildRoot:      %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)

BuildRequires:  bison
BuildRequires:  flex
BuildRequires:  kdelibs4-devel
%{?_kde4_version:Requires:kdelibs4%{?_isa} >= %{_kde4_version}}

%description
KDevelop-PG-Qt is a parser generator written in readable source-code and
generating readable source-code. Its syntax was inspired by AntLR. It
implements the visitor-pattern and uses the Qt library. That is why it
is ideal to be used in Qt-/KDE-based applications like KDevelop.

%package devel
Group:    Development/Libraries
Summary:  Developer files for %{name}
Requires: %{name} = %{version}-%{release}
Requires: kdelibs4-devel
# contains only noarch content, avoids being needlessly multilib'd
BuildArch: noarch
%description devel
%{summary}.


%prep
%setup -q -n kdevelop-pg-qt-%{version}


%build
mkdir -p %{_target_platform}
pushd %{_target_platform}
%{cmake_kde4} ..
popd

make %{?_smp_mflags} -C %{_target_platform}


%install
rm -rf %{buildroot}

make install/fast DESTDIR=%{buildroot} -C %{_target_platform}


%clean
rm -rf %{buildroot}


%files 
%defattr(-,root,root,-)
%doc AUTHORS COPYING.LIB README
%{_bindir}/kdev-pg-qt

%files devel
%defattr(-,root,root,-)
%{_includedir}/kdevelop-pg-qt/
%{_kde4_appsdir}/cmake/modules/FindKDevelop-PG-Qt.cmake


%changelog
* Thu Dec 14 2010 Rex Dieter <rdieter@fedoraproject.org> - 0.9.0-3
- License: LGPLv2+ and GPLv2+ with exception

* Fri Dec 10 2010 Rex Dieter <rdieter@fedoraproject.org> - 0.9.0-2
- License: GPLv2+

* Mon Dec 06 2010 Rex Dieter <rdieter@fedoraproject.org> - 0.9.0-1
- first try